**Ticket: Expired creds blocking password-reset revamp QA**

Hey — the staging token for the Mirelock reset-flow service expired over the weekend, so the whole QA pass for the revamped flow is stalled. I've minted a fresh credential scoped to staging only; it's good for 30 days. Before you cut the release candidate, swap it into the deploy config using the key below.

service key, tahaf-yaduf: qvz11-icGvt2med8u

## KioskPine Watchdog — restart procedure

If the kiosk UI freezes, the watchdog should auto-restart within 30s. If it doesn't: SSH to the unit, check `watchdogd` status, and confirm heartbeat logs are under 10s old. Stale heartbeats usually mean the env file got wiped by the imaging script. Recreate `/opt/kioskpine/.env` from the golden copy, restoring poll interval, display ID, and restart backoff. The watchdog's reporting credential goes on the next line of that file:

sealed setting: RELAY_SECRET13=bca49b02a6971

## Releases

Hey future maintainer — this section covers shipping Textomatic, our encoding sniffer for uploaded files. Every release bumps the detection tables (yes, even the weird legacy codepages someone in Dunmore still uploads), so don't skip the table-regen step or BOM-less UTF-16 files will misdetect again. Tag the build, run the conformance suite, and let the pipeline produce the tarball. We sign everything; unsigned artifacts get rejected by the updater on purpose. For verification, the current release signing key is the following.

deploy key for kawip-yajef: bky13_3Ar26RfYwhUJD

TICKET: Quill Search relevance tuning — field boost audit. We adjusted title and synonym boosts on the Ferrowell cluster and re-ran the offline judgment set; NDCG improved modestly, but the changes touch the query rewriter, which has access to per-tenant dictionaries. Please review whether boosted synonym expansion could leak terms across tenant boundaries before we promote. All experiments ran in the isolated Harkvale staging ring with scrubbed logs. The exact build under review is listed directly below.

pipeline stamp: htk3_a71